Key Technology Progress and Enlightenment in Refracturing of Shale Gas Horizontal Wells

Abstract: Due to the unfavorable factors of initial stimulation treatment in shale gas horizontal wells, the output is less than expected, coupled with the current downturn in the oil price background, shale gas horizontal wells refracturing technology is increasingly concerned about the development of shale gas resources. With the continuous development of fracturing technology, many shale gas fields have now successfully implemented this technique to increase production rate and to enhance ultimate gas recovery from shale gas wells. Overviewed the procedure for candidate well identification and discussed the key fracturing techniques and operation monitoring techniques. Lastly, based on the current situation of the development of different techniques, the direction of the refracturing technique of shale gas horizontal wells were prospected. Some suggestions were put forward, such as selecting wells with "big data" technology, flexible restoration of casing damaged and deformed wells, fracture monitoring based on damage mechanics, and fracturing fluid and proppant with new materials. As China is abundant in potential shale gas reserve, to accelerate the formation of supporting technology suitable for shale gas horizontal wells refracturing in China can play a role in promoting the commercial development of shale gas in China in the future.

Key words: shale gas horizontal well, refracturing, candidate well identification, fracturing technology, operation monitoring
